Cross tab / filter the lines of pivot
Hello guys,.It's been a day and I can't understand how to filter PivotTables using RTF Model Designer in word.
The web-page-builder has a filter function, but the RTF an it is missing from the menu. So I think there must be some scripts.
I had up to now:
<? If: cartype = 4? >
<? end if? >
but I don't know where to put it, I tried to place on each item but... no luck.
Someone there done that before and can share the secret?
Hi BIPuser,
Finally, it worked. I added the following to the for each element.
----------
---------------------------
Tags: Business Intelligence
Similar Questions
-
problem with tabs and filter the lines of memory cache
Dear all I have a problem with the oaf page has two tabs under two of them consists of a table and add the button to the row. Second tab, it's a detail of the first tab, which means that each line in the first tab may refer to one or more lines in the second tab, my problem is when I add the line in the first tab and go to the second tab to add lines to this line of the display of the page added all lines not only the matching lines.
my code:
1 - controller
When press Tab of Lot lines (partial action)
If (goLotsTab".equals (pageContext.getParameter (OAWebBeanConstants.EVENT_PARAM))) {" "}String trxLineId = "38";//row.getAttribute("TrxLineId").toString(); "
AddLotParam serializable [] = {trxLineId};
am.invokeMethod ("getTrxLot", addLotParam);
}
What press Add button lines of lots (partial action)
If (addLot".equals (pageContext.getParameter (OAWebBeanConstants.EVENT_PARAM))) {" "}
String trxLineId = "38"; row.getAttribute("TrxLineId").toString ();
AddLotParam serializable [] = {trxLineId};
am.invokeMethod ("addTrxLot", addLotParam);
}When press Add a tab line (partial action)
If (addLine".equals (pageContext.getParameter (OAWebBeanConstants.EVENT_PARAM))) {" "}
am.invokeMethod ("addLine", params);
}Methods 2 - am
public void getTrxLot (String pTrxLineId)
{
OAViewObject vo = (OAViewObject) getXXSiteLotsVO1 ();
LinVo OAViewObject = (OAViewObject) getXXSiteLineVO2 ();Line linRow = linVo.getFirstFilteredRow ("SelectLineFlag", "Y");
pTrxLineId = linRow.getAttribute("TrxLineId").toString ();If (!) VO.isPreparedForExecution ())
//{
try {}
String existringWhereClause = vo.getWhereClause ();
vo.setWhereClauseParams (null);
vo.setWhereClause("trx_line_id=:1");
vo.setWhereClauseParam (0, (pTrxLineId) Number);
vo.executeQuery ();
vo.setWhereClauseParams (null);
vo.setWhereClause (existringWhereClause);
}
catch (Exception exceptionl)
{
throw OAException.wrapperException (exceptionl);
}// }
following line is commented, but I think that it will contribute to the memory of the filter
cached data to be mapped.Rank [] lotRows = vo.getFilteredRows ("TrxLineId1", pTrxLineId);
}/////////////////////////////////////////////////////////////////
public void addTrxLot (String pTrxLineId)
{
OAViewObject vo = (OAViewObject) getXXSiteLotsVO1 ();
LinVo OAViewObject = (OAViewObject) getXXSiteLineVO2 ();Line linRow = linVo.getFirstFilteredRow ("SelectLineFlag", "Y");
pTrxLineId = linRow.getAttribute("TrxLineId").toString ();If (vo.getFetchedRowCount () == 0) {}
vo.setMaxFetchSize (0);
// }VO. Last();
VO. Next();
Line = vo.createRow ();
row.setAttribute ("TrxLineId", pTrxLineId);
vo.insertRow (row);
row.setNewRowState (Row.STATUS_INITIALIZED);
}OK, I'll share my latest code using other
public void createTransaction() {}
OAViewObjectImpl vo = getXXSiteHeaderVO1();
If (! vo.isPreparedForExecution ()) {}
vo.executeQuery ();
}
If (vo.getFetchedRowCount () == 0)
{
vo.setMaxFetchSize (0);
}
String status = "incomplete."
OADBTransaction txn = (OADBTransaction) getOADBTransaction ();
- oracle.jbo.domain.Date currentDate = txn.getCurrentUserDate ();
Line = vo.createRow ();
row.setAttribute ("TrxStatus", status);
- row.setAttribute ("TrxDate", currentDate);
vo.insertRow (row);
row.setNewRowState (Row.STATUS_INITIALIZED);
}
{} public void addLine (String pTrxHeeaderId)
OAViewObject vo = (OAViewObject) this.getXXSiteTrxVL1 () .getDestination ();
VO. Last();
VO. Next();
Line = vo.createRow ();
int linNum = vo.getFetchedRowCount () + 1;
row.setAttribute ("TrxHeaderId", pTrxHeeaderId);
row.setAttribute ("LineNum", String.valueOf (linNum));
row.setAttribute ("SelectLineFlag", "Y");
vo.insertRow (row);
row.setNewRowState (Row.STATUS_INITIALIZED);
}
Public Sub getTrxLot()
{
LinVo OAViewObject = (OAViewObject) this.getXXSiteTrxVL1 () .getDestination ();
Line linRow = linVo.getFirstFilteredRow ("SelectLineFlag", "Y");
String pTrxLineId = linRow.getAttribute("TrxLineId").toString ();
linVo.setCurrentRow (linRow);
OAViewObject vo = (OAViewObject) this.getXXSiteLineLotsVL1 () .getDestination ();
}
Public Sub addTrxLot()
{
LinVo OAViewObject = (OAViewObject) this.getXXSiteTrxVL1 () .getDestination ();
Line linRow = linVo.getFirstFilteredRow ("SelectLineFlag", "Y");
String pTrxLineId = linRow.getAttribute("TrxLineId").toString ();
linVo.setCurrentRow (linRow);
OAViewObject vo = (OAViewObject) this.getXXSiteLineLotsVL1 () .getDestination ();
VO. Last();
VO. Next();
Line = vo.createRow ();
row.setAttribute ("TrxLineId", pTrxLineId);
row.setAttribute ("RowKey", new oracle.jbo.domain.Number (1));
vo.insertRow (row);
row.setNewRowState (Row.STATUS_INITIALIZED);
}
-
possible to encapsulate cross tab on the same page, rather than on the next page?
Hello
I'm working on a report on the cross tab in .rtf. I noticed that when there are more columns that can fit on a page, the prosecution is carried out on a new page. Is it possible to have continued to perform on the next 'line' under the first instead of on the next page?
Thank you
JKIt's here :)
http://winrichman.blogspot.com/2009/05/cross-tab-by-limiting-number-of-colums.html
-
Previously, the firefox button was upstairs on the left and tabs lined up beside him, so that reached the top of the tabs just to the top of the screen. Close/minimize etc. were at the top right.
Two days ago it so that the firefox button is at the top left, close/minimize etc. are always in the top left, but now the tabs are on a line located underneath, leaving a space at the top where I can see through to the desktop. There is also a wider border than before, around the window of Firefox all, more space wasted.
I have windows 7 on top of my desk quick links bar, now that firefox has left a void that is located above the tabs, it means that it is easier to accidentally hovering over the bar when changing tabs, it's awkward because it brings forward and disrupts the ability to quickly change tabs.
You see the difference between a magnified window and a window "restored down." Click on the middle button in the upper right of the Firefox window, so that when you place the pointer over the button, it says 'Restore down' and a show of boxes double overlap.
-
Tab control: all objects in different tabs of the line
I have a tab with 6 tabs control. Each tab has exactly the same things: two graphics and digital indicator. I want the objects on each tab of too each other perfectly. When the user moves from page to page, I do not want the user to see any movement due to a misalignment of the objects among the tabs. What is the best way? Thank you!
Create a property for each element node and copy the Position of one of the indicators to all other indicators of the same type.
See attachment.
You can also use an array of clusters instead of a tab control. Put the graphics and digital indicators in a cluster. Put them in a table. Only display a single element of the array at the same time, but the table control allows to change is visible.
This will probably make your code simpler and more logical also.
-
How to filter the lines in the engine of demand?
Hi gurus,
I have an APP engine that updates the custom table that gets inserted from the combination of 3 different tables of the PS.
If any of the PS table used in select Insert changes/updates, I need to update my data table custom through the app engine.
How to read lines that actuall changed?
for example:
I have 1000 lines of the select query, out of which only 10 rows of data is changed.
In the app engine, if I come to write the update statement it will process all 1000 lines to check the custom table update.
How to select only 10 lines and send it to my sql update?
Thanks in advance
In your DoSelect, you can use a subselect for rows that are modified.
so, something like:
Assuming you are using Oracle:
OF CustomTable has
IF (A.field1, A.field2, A.field3) ARE NOT (SELECT B.field1, B.field2, B.field3 OF Table B and add a clause where clause to limit the results of the subquery)
-
How to filter the lines in the source file
Hello
Small question.
There are data records in 'source.txt' that are useless and I need to remove them before running our ODI Inc_stmt cube to load. Is it possible to do?
Where do I put this command to filter for this (filter REBS that are based on the value of a column?Download the getting started guide, which will help understand the basic features of ODI 10 g - http://download.oracle.com/docs/cd/E15985_01/doc.10136/getstart/GSETL.pdf
In this guide if you go to the page number - 42 here you will find 'set the filter of order', which should help you.
-
Cross tab in the SELECT statement?
Hello
The following SQL statement:
SELECT
T.LASTFIRST, C.COURSE_NAME, CC. COURSE_NUMBER, CC. SECTION_NUMBER, CC. EXPRESSION, ST. SEX, COUNT (CC.) STUDENTID) STUDENTCOUNT
TEACHERS T
JOIN THE CC
ON CC. TEACHERID = T.DCID
JOIN THE COURSE C
ON C.COURSE_NUMBER = CC. COURSE_NUMBER
JOIN STUDENTS ST
ON CC. STUDENTID = ST.ID
WHERE CC. SCHOOLID = 100 AND TERMID > = 1900
T.LASTFIRST, C.COURSE_NAME, CC GROUP. COURSE_NUMBER, CC. SECTION_NUMBER, CC. EXPRESSION, ST. BETWEEN THE SEXES
ORDER OF T.LASTFIRST, CC. COURSE_NUMBER, CC. SECTION_NUMBER, CC. EXPRESSION, ST. BETWEEN THE SEXES
Returns the following dataset:
Abram, American history Michael SOC1000 1 a 2 F 7
Abram, American history Michael SOC1000 1 has 2 M 12
Is there a way to make the count gender for each sex, introduce yourself as a column in the SELECT statement so that there is only ONE row returned by course number with as FEMALECOUNT and MALECOUNT column headers?
I tried to use a statement select count nested inside the original SELECT statement but without success.
JeffYou should be able to use a CASE statement for this in collaboration with the County. COUNTY does not indicate that null instances no I have not specified a part to the CASE ELSE (so the default value is NULL).
COUNT(CASE ST.GENDER WHEN 'F' THEN 1 END) as Female_count, COUNT(CASE ST.GENDER WHEN 'M' THEN 1 END) as Male_count,
Note that you need to remove the Gender of your query column.
-
To filter the data according to the year of the field date of a table
Hi I have a table
I want to select this table ID values by comparing the year in the area of set_date.TABLE T1(ID NUMBER, SET_DATE DATE)
To do this, I wrote
It returns no rows.select id from t1 where set_date like '%2010%' ;
But the following code does not work
Although the second code works there is an inability in these two codes because I do not specify to correspond to the year. It is quite possible that 10 can be present anywhere else, and this query returns all the lines. So how to filter the lines by year?select id from t1 where set_date like '%10%' ;
Hello
Here's a way
select id from t1 where extract(year from set_date) = 2010 ;
Concerning
Peter -
With the help of buttons to filter the interactive report
I have an interactive relationship with a default filter set up. Now, I would like to have buttons to modify the SELECT statement used for the report. While I need not make a new page of interactive report for each button. I want to provide the user with a buttons show all reports, view reports on demand and completed report. Everyone will just filter the lines accordingly. What is the best way to achieve this?
Thank you!Hello
You can created a where clause clause in your IR as:
Select...
Of...
where report_type like 'at the request of the reports' and: p1_button_value = 1
or report_type like 'Finished reports' and: p1_button_value = 2
or: p1_button_value = 3Now, you create your button and an element called: p1_button_value. Function of the key, you click on the value of your Exchange item. If you need display different columns, then go to the column and change the condition:
: p1_button_value = 1It will be useful,
Tobias
----------------
http://Apex-at-work.blogspot.com/ -
How to open a new tab from the address line?
How to open a new tab from the address line?
You will need to hold down the ALT key and press ENTER to open the link in a new tab without the use of an extension cord.
By default the links always open in the same tab.You can search the Addons site for an extension if you want to change this default behavior.
-
hit the tab opens another line of address rather than go to the subject field
With the last update to Thunderbird, I can not tab directly from the field address within the scope of the topic. Hit the tab opens another line of address to be removed, then tab will move to the scope of the topic. I hope someone solves this problem quickly.
In my version 31.2.0
It depends on how MANY fields are automatically inserted.So if I have 3 set as default, but have used an email address, tab scrolls the (two) other TO and in THE fields and then go to topic.
The rest to THE fields may not necessarily appear if the content by separating the divider was raised to provide more space to strike. So it might appear as though the creation of a new FIELD (which is normally when you press the enter/return key), but it's actually only to already available in THE fields.
To check this:
Open a new message of Scripture.
Lower the separator bar to reveal header space, all the fields to display and also a few extra empty lines.
How many auto fields appear?Place the cursor at the top of the page to and use Tab to move.
the move of the tab should move from FIELD to the fall of choice FOR down, then next field. When the last FIELD was used, tab should go to the question, it should not go to an empty field AND create a new FIELD. -
The line to type under the tabs disappeared. How can I get that back?
The line under the tabs - where I could type in a question, view the address of the web site or web site is missing. How can I get that back?
Hi WriteGirl,
You can click View > toolbars > and check "Bar of Navigation" to get this back bar.
-
Basically, need a feature that allows the user to rearrange the location of tab line (ie: the ability to drag the line to a different location). For me, it would be moved from the line Summit of 4.01 on line facing down(as the place where it sits in versions of X 3.6), just above the window of the web page. That would make it very convenient to click on multiple back when necessary. What I constantly in my case.
I thank you for your public service and a great work all you do!
You can right click on the orange Firefox button to open the menu of the toolbar.
- Click "Tabs at the top" to remove the check mark and place the tab to its original position bar just above the browser window.
-
5.6.1 MacBook early 2015 OS X 10.11.3 pages
Question: How can I easily format a series of "a line of questions / answers" (questions and answers on the same line.)
How to easily create a long series of a single line of questions and answers to the question aligning it on the left and the end of the response by aligning right?
For example
!. Type the short question on the left margin.
2. tab at the right margin.
3. type the answer with the end of the answer on the right margin.
Insert a right tab at the right margin.
Peter
Maybe you are looking for
-
PAV dv6747cl: AMD turion 64 x 2 2 TL-60 GHz, only running 800mzh?
Hello I came across a CPU speed Tester and decided to test AMD Turion TL-60 of my Pavilion dv6747cl It reported only 800 mzh as clock speed and not the 2 GHz, as shown in the vista system information. This is the normal behavior of the processor? It
-
Windows 7 causes problems for screen - horizontal lines
I recently installed Windows 7 Ultimate a week ago and in the last two days, when I started my laptop to the top, after 10 minutes, I get suddenly color horizontal lines in the blocks on my screen (screen goes blue or black with colored lines flicker
-
RV220W does not generate status field in the Certificate Signing Request
Latest firmware RV220W. I can't get this to generate state information in a CSR. I tried everything, including just S = NA. When I run the present through a CSR decoder status information is missing. My CA will not accept the request. We never saw it
-
Media Encoder has stopped working
Ok... Media Encoder has stopped working for me. I just get the popup "Adobe Media Enoder CC 2015.0 has stopped working". I tried all the suggested fixes but still nothing! It worked until the last update.Tried to delete the C:\Program Files (x 86) ed